One of the best parts of Steampunk fashion is the resourcefulness and engineering of its followers. Functional contraptions and fantastic jewelery designs are often the hallmark of the industry and the work that goes into these products is often complex and inspired – reminiscent of a time of experimentation and industrial exploration.

The unique sculptures and detailed jewelery by Catherinette rings conjures dreams of bizarre delights with their obvious mastery of imagination and architecture. Clockwork arachnids, gazing gemstone eyes and attention grabbing jewelery gives one an immersive feeling into the culture they cater to. These aren’t just trinkets and glitter; they’re a treasure all on their own.

With gorgeous rings (ranging from around $40-$60), fine necklaces and bracelets ($70-$100) and some amazing art sculptures ($200 - $1000) there’s a whole host of items to chose from.
